Answer: 70

=====================================

Explanation:

The exterior angles (2x+12) and (2x) have corresponding interior angles 180-(2x+12) and 180-(2x)

Triangle ABC has the following interior angles

A = 112

B = 180 - 2x

C = 180 - (2x+12) = 180-2x-12 = 168-2x

Add up the interior angles for A,B,C and set the result equal to 180. Solve for x

A+B+C = 180

(112)+(180-2x)+(168-2x) = 180

112+180-2x+168-2x = 180

460-4x = 180

-4x = 180-460

-4x = -280

x = -280/(-4)

x = 70

---------------

Side note:

2x = 2*70 = 140 is the exterior angle for B, so 180-140 = 40 is the interior angle for angle B

2x+12 = 2*70+12 = 152 is the exterior angle for C, so 180 - 152 = 28 is the interior angle for C

Add up the interior angles to find that A+B+C = 112+40+28 = 180, so this helps confirm we have the right x value.
